طراح محصول در صبا ایده
۴۰۴ هم صفحهای از سایت شماست!
در آپارات روزانه چندین هزار ویدیو توسط کاربران منتشر میشود و حجم زیادی ویدیوی ثبت شده(index) از آپارات در گوگل داریم. برخی از ویدیوها توسط خود کاربران یا به دلیل گزارش تخلف دیگر کاربران بعد از ثبت در گوگل، پاک میشود. معمولا این تعداد از ویدیوی پاکشده، به جایی میرسد که ما حجم بسیار زیادی آدرس داریم که تبدیل به خطای 404(صفحه مورد نظر پیدا نشد) میشوند و با توجه به حجم بازدید آپارات، میلیونها بازدید در ماه، به صفحه 404 برخورد خواهند کرد.

اگر بپرسید در صفحه خطای 404 به دنبال چه هدفی هستید؟ پاسخ این است که ما از پاک شدن ویدیوها و 404 شدن آدرسها نمیتوانیم جلوگیری کنیم، ولی میتوانیم کسی که به صفحه خطای ما برخورد کردهاست را همچنان در سایت نگه داریم.
در این مطلب توضیح خواهم داد که چطور بدون دست بردن در طراحی صفحه 404 و صرفا با تغییر نوع محتوا در حالتهای مختلف، از پرش(bounce) یک میلیون بازدید در ماه جلوگیری کردیم؟

در سایتهای محتوا محور برای جلوگیری از ریزش کاربران در صفحات 404، متداول است که تعدادی محتواهای پیشنهادی را بجای محتوایی که دیگر وجود ندارد نمایش میدهند. که این روش در آپارات هم انجام میشد؛ یعنی در صفحه 404، ویدیوهای پربازدیدِ آپارات را به کاربران پیشنهاد میکردیم و به عنوان یک پلتفرم (UGC(user generated content در حال نمایش بهترینهای محتوای خودمان بودیم. به نظر هم میرسید که همه چیز مرتب است و یک صفحه 404 استاندارد با آمار قابل قبول داریم.
اما چه چیزی کم بود یا چطور میتوانستیم صفحه 404 بهتری داشته باشیم؟
هدف ما در آپارات این است که از زنجیره میلیونها ویدیو، نزدیکترین پیشنهادها را به تقاضای کاربر نشان دهیم. اما دقیقا در صفحه 404 آپارات خلاف این موضوع عمل میکردیم! ما نزدیکترین ویدیوها را نسبت به خواست و موقعیت کاربر نشان نمیدادیم! ما صرفا پربازدیدترین ویدیوهای آپارات را نشان میدادیم!
نمایش ویدیوهای پربازدید با این که ویدیوهای خوبی بودند اما دو اشکال عمده داشتند:
نخست این که ویدیوهای پربازدید از هر موضوعی بودند، همچنین ویدیوهای پربازدید براساس موضوعاتِ روز، تغییر میکردند. برای مثال، در ایام جامجهانی احتمالا ویدیوهای پربازدید آپارات، ویدیوهای فوتبالی هستند و این امکان وجود دارد که کاربری که به صفحه 404 آمدهاست، اصلا به فوتبال علاقه نداشته باشد.

برای گرفتن بهترین نتیجه دو تا تغییر دادیم:
تغییر اول، استفاده مجدد از محتوای مرده!
کاربری که به صفحه 404 رسیدهاست، احتمالا دنبال چیزی بوده که دیگر وجود ندارد! به همین دلیل به این نتیجه رسیدیم که به کاربر ویدیوهای جایگزینی را نشان دهیم که به خاطر آن به این صفحه هدایت شدهاست.
برای مثال، آدرس یک ویدیو درباره جشنواره فجر به 404 تبدیل شدهاست. کافیست ویدیوهایی که در صفحه 404 به کاربر پیشنهاد میشود به جای پربازدیدهای آپارات، در مورد جشنواره فجر و موضوعات نزدیک به آن، مثلا سینما باشد. بنابراین برای صفحات 404 شده، ویدیوهایی که محتوای مرتبط داشتند را پیشنهاد دادیم.
برای پیشنهاد دادن این محتوای مشابه و نزدیک در ابتدا باید بدانید که سیستم پیشنهاد آپارات(recommendation) به چه صورت است؟ که به طور خلاصه ترکیبی از پنج مورد زیر است:
- سابقه تماشای کاربران
- کانال هایی که دنبال میکنند.
- موارد پر بازدیدی که در دستهبندی خود داغ هستند که با پربازدیدهای کل آپارات متفاوت است.
- ویدیوهای جذاب تولیدکنندگان آپارات
- ویدیوهایی که ارتباط محتوایی نزدیک و مشابهی با خود ویدیو دارند.

نتیجه تغییر اول:
در راستای تغییر اول نتیجه خوبی گرفتیم، نزدیک به 1 میلیون بازدید در ماه، کمتر در صفحات ۴۰۴ Bounce شدند! بگذارید بهتر بگویم، حدود 75 درصد ورودی این صفحه آپارات از گوگل است تا قبل این تغییر دست کم میلیونها ورودی گوگل با ورود به این صفحه و نگرفتن نتیجه مطلوب این صفحه را ترک می کردند اگر کمی با معیارهای گوگل آشنا باشید می دانید که این اتفاق خوبی نبود.
نکته: احتمالا برای شما این سوال پیش بیاید چطور صفحاتی که تبدیل به 404 شدند ورودی از گوگل دارند؟ طبق آمار ما اگر صفحهای در گوگل ایندکس شده و بعد تبدیل به 404 بشود حدود 4 تا 6 روز بعد از این اتفاق هم همچنان ورودی دارد.

تغییر دوم، چه کار دیگه ای میشد انجام داد؟
ما از تغییر نمایش محتوای پربازدید به محتوای نسبتا مشابه نتیجه خوبی گرفتیم، پس به این فکر افتادیم که در راستای پیشنهادهای متدوالِ ویدیو در آپارات، محتوای پیشنهادیِ(recommendation) سفارشی سازی شدهای به کاربر نشان دهیم. با توجه به نتایجی که در تغییر اول بدست آوردیم، همانطور که گفتیم با بررسی ورودیهای این صفحه دیدیم که 75 درصد ترافیک ورودی از موتورهای جستجو هستند. به این معنی که شخص جستجوکننده به طور حتم دنبال همان موضوع خاصی است که الان دیگر نیست.
پس به این نتیجه رسیدیم میتوانیم پیشنهادات را کاملا تغییر دهیم و عواملی مانند “داغ بودن” یا “برگزیده بودن” در همان دستهبندی یا “دنبال شده توسط کاربر” را حذف و فقط ویدیوهای مرتبط را نمایش دهیم. انتظار میرفت که مجددا تغییر محسوسی را ببینیم.

نتیجه تغییر دوم:
نتیجه خلاف چیزی بود که فکر میکردیم. نه تنها مثبت نشد بلکه مقدار کمی هم افت کرد! اما چرا؟ مگر کاربرها با جستجو و انتخاب نتایج و یا کلیک به روی لینک به آن صفحه نرسیده بودند و ما هم چیزی که به دنبالش بودند را کاملا به آنها نشان ندادیم؟ جواب مثبت است اما این تغییر فقط برای کسانی که از گوگل آمدند مفید بود نه همه کاربران:

طبق تصویر بالا، ما در سگمنت کاربران ورودی از گوگل، روی نرخ پرش(Bounce rate)، درصد خوبی بهبود، در صفحه داشتیم. اما برای کسانی که به طور مستقیم(direct) آمده بودند اینطور نبود.
جمعبندی:
- ما از این تغییر متوجه شدیم، کسی که از موتور جستجو وارد شده، قطعا دنبال نزدیکترین محتوا به محتوایی است که دیگر وجود ندارد، اما کسی که از دایرکت وارد شده(برای مثال با کلیک روی یه لینک اشتراک گذاشته شده در پیام رسانها)، فقط به دنبال آن محتوا نیست و دلایل دیگر نیز میتواند باعث نگه داشتن آن کاربر در صفحه و کلیک روی پیشنهادات ما شود.
- در نهایت چیزی که امروز وجود دارد ابتدا با استفاده از محتوای مرده، مرتبط کردن محتوای پیشنهادی و سپس با در نظر گرفتن ورودی به کاربر ویدیو پیشنهاد میشود، اگر شما از طریق موتورهای جستجو به 404 آپارات برسید، جنس محتواها ببشتر از جنس محتوایی هست که دیگر وجود ندارد. اگر هم بصورت مستقیم(Direct) به این صفحه بربخورید جنس محتواها ترکیبی از موارد داغ در آن موضوع، ویدیوهای برگزیده در آن دسته بندی، کانال هایی که دنبال میکنید و محتواهای نزدیک به آن ویدیو است.

- در موارد شخصی سازی محتوا و سیستم پیشنهاد(recommendation) همیشه به دنبال آن هستیم که کاربر کیست؟ و چه گذشتهای دارد؟ اما به این نکته کمتر توجه میشود که گاهی کاربرها بر اساس جایی که از آن آمدهاند نیز متفاوت عمل میکنند.
- زمانی که تغییری ایجاد میکنید این امکان وجود دارد که به طور کلی نتایج منفی بگیرید، اما ممکن است این تغییر بر گروهی از افراد تاثیر بسیار مثبتی بگذارد پس نتیجه هر تغییری را باید در گروهیهای مختلف سنجید.
پینوشت: ما تو وبلاگ تیم محصول آپارات سعی کردیم مطالبی را که دوست داریم با شما به اشتراک بگذاریم که گزارشی از مسیر تجارب ما هستند که ممکن است عاری از اشتباه نباشد. مهم تر از نوشتن ما و مهم تر از اینکه راهکارهای ما برای مشکلات بهترین راه ممکن هستند یا نه، قصد داریم پیشنهادات و انتقادات شما رو دریافت کنیم تا در کنار هم یاد بگیریم و تبادل اطلاعات کنیم.
منتظر پیشنهادات و انتقادات شما در دیدگاههای aparat.design یا توییتر @aparat_design هستیم.
مطلبی دیگر از این انتشارات
چطور تست کاربردپذیری در طراحی جدید به ما کمک کرد؟
مطلبی دیگر از این انتشارات
5 نکته سئویی برای تیتر جذاب در ویدیو
مطلبی دیگر از این انتشارات
الگوی OUTBOX برای تبادل دادهها در میکروسرویسها